Which p&t is the 'lightest' to push?

Trying to weigh up the pros and cons of the explorer and the vibe. Does anyone know which feels the easiest to push? Starting off with a 2+2m and a newborn. Invisage needing it for at least a year. So pushing a 3 year old and 1 year old about!

I've got an explorer and the same age gap

It weighs a frickin tonne. I hate it, it cumbersome, weighty, yet somehow unstable and flimsy

However it is the only pushchair that fitted our requirements (a bit). Mostly just because it's narrow

Can't wait until DS is big enough for me to flog it

The Verve was not the lightest. Amongst the pushchairs I have tried its been middling - ie not light, but not the heaviest either. More towards heavy than light though. The Dash wasn't too bad but it wasnt great all around and I found it hard to control when dropping off kerbs.

i find the explorer fine with a 3yr old and 1yr old.

do make sure the tyres are inflated properly as this makes a lot of different to the push IME
